My Buying Guides on Anua Heartleaf Pore Control Cleansing Oil Review
My First Impressions
When I first tried the Anua Heartleaf Pore Control Cleansing Oil, I liked how lightweight it felt on my skin. It didn’t have a heavy or greasy texture, which made it easy for me to massage across my face. I also noticed that it spread well and felt gentle, even around my eyes and nose area.
What I Looked for in a Cleansing Oil
For me, a good cleansing oil needs to remove makeup, sunscreen, and daily buildup without leaving my skin tight or irritated. I wanted something that could help with clogged pores but still feel calming. The Anua Heartleaf formula stood out to me because it is made with heartleaf, which I associate with soothing and sensitive-skin-friendly care.
How It Performed on My Skin
In my experience, this cleansing oil did a solid job breaking down makeup and excess oil. I found that it rinsed off fairly well when I followed it with a second cleanser. My skin felt clean afterward, but not stripped. That balance mattered to me because I prefer products that cleanse deeply while still keeping my skin comfortable.
Texture and Feel
I personally liked the texture because it felt smooth and easy to work with. It wasn’t too thick, so I could spread it quickly across my face. During use, it gave me a gentle massage-like feel, which made cleansing feel a little more relaxing.
Best For My Skin Concerns
If I am dealing with clogged pores, mild blackheads, or buildup from sunscreen, I find this kind of cleansing oil useful. I also think it suits me on days when my skin feels a bit sensitive or easily irritated. For my routine, it works best when I want a cleanser that is effective but not harsh.
What I Liked Most
What I appreciated most was how gentle it felt while still doing a good cleansing job. I also liked that it didn’t leave a strong oily residue after rinsing. Another plus for me was that it fit easily into my double-cleansing routine.
What I Would Consider Before Buying
Before buying, I would think about whether I prefer a cleansing oil or a balm. I would also check if my skin reacts well to oil cleansers in general. For my needs, I find it helpful to use cleansing oils only when I plan to follow up with a water-based cleanser.
My Final Verdict
Overall, I think the Anua Heartleaf Pore Control Cleansing Oil is a good option if I want a gentle yet effective first cleanse. In my experience, it feels soothing, removes impurities well, and supports my pore-care routine without being too harsh. If I were choosing a cleansing oil for everyday use, this would be one I’d seriously consider.
